What Is a Car Key Auto Locksmith?
Modern cars do not use traditional metal keys anymore and require specialized technology to start the car. In these instances, a locksmith is the most suitable person to contact.
It is crucial to provide accurate information when calling an auto locksmith. This includes the vehicle's model, make and year and the VIN number and proof that you're the owner.
Reputation
A auto-locksmith for your car key is a professional that can help you solve any issue you might face regarding the locks or keys of your vehicle. These professionals can unlock your car that is locked, repair damaged locks or replace a lost key. Some locksmiths are able to repair or replace the ignition switch.
When you have a problem with your car keys it can be stressful. You might have locked yourself out at 1am Friday night, or tossed your only key in the bath. These situations can be more frustrating if they happen in a location that's difficult to seek help from, such as the Walmart parking lot or a gas station in the middle of nowhere.
It is common for people to lock their cars or lose them in the future. A spare set of keys is an excellent idea. You can call your local dealer to request the replacement key, however it could be expensive. You can also locate an independent locksmith in your area which is less expensive and quicker than visiting a car dealer.
Car locksmiths offer a broad variety of services, such as removing broken keys, duplicating or replacing them, as well as in some cases -- replacing whole locks and ignition switches. Their prices vary, but they tend to be lower than the price you'd spend at a dealership.
Another service that locksmiths from car can provide is programming the new key to work with your vehicle. A lot of cars have key fobs that are connected to the internal computer in the car. This makes it extremely difficult to hack or copy these kinds of keys. A locksmith for cars can program a new lock to be compatible with your car's computer system.
If you're experiencing problems with your car's keys It is advised to call an auto locksmith as soon as possible. They can unlock vehicles quickly and safely, without causing any damage. They can also assist you with other issues, such as changing the ignition.

Tools
Car locksmiths who cut keys have a variety of tools at their disposal to help them deal with various situations. They can use these tools to cut keys and program smart keys or even repair the ignition if it has been damaged. They also have a range of lockout tools that permit them to gain access to vehicles without damaging the lock. This lets them get customers back into their vehicles quickly and easily.
The automotive lockout kit, slim jammers and electronic cloning tools are among the most important tools needed by an auto locksmith. The tool for unlocking the car locksmiths near me is used to create a gap within the door frame. This is then used to force the lock in. The kit also comes with an oil that makes picking the lock simpler. A slim jim is a small piece of spring steel that has the right shapes cut into it to grip the locking mechanism inside a vehicle.
A device that duplicates a transponder can be programmed for a particular vehicle. This is especially useful if your keys have been lost or stolen. These devices are expensive with prices ranging from $3,000 to $3000 however they're very durable and easy-to-use. They are available at a variety of hardware stores as well as on the internet.
In contrast to the older locks which have a code on the keys, modern keys for cars are protected by computer chips. This means that they have to be programmed to work in a particular vehicle that requires specialized equipment and software. To do this, a locksmith has to first acquire the appropriate programming protocols for the specific vehicle model. There are a variety of companies that produce these tools, including Advanced Diagnostics (AD). They sell their products under a variety names, including T-Code Pro and Codeseeker.
After the technician has programmed a key, they need to test it to ensure that it works properly. If not, they'll need to go through the process again. It can be a long and expensive procedure. Therefore, it is crucial that an auto locksmith is equipped with the right tools to do this job.
